Output 81e86c61c3ea082fe80ae56ddd07789730aed8c4dca5fa5be110c1661fefdbdc:1

value
368677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6515d2aebf5c6d89f2735938fcc2f66481539c1 OP_EQUAL
address
3KmdBns6ip3oHin4MqwKunW3LmWfxw3utw
transaction
81e86c61c3ea082fe80ae56ddd07789730aed8c4dca5fa5be110c1661fefdbdc
confirmations
397635
spent
true